How to get Better Sleep at Night

A healthy and a proper sleep has various advantages as it helps in keeping a person fresh, active and energetic throughout the day. It refreshes and rejuvenates the mind and body of a person thereby helping in reducing problems associated with stress and strain. However, various people struggle with attaining a proper sleep which in turn hampers their mood and energy and makes them lethargic, irritated and fatigued. Unless one is suffering from a serious sleep disorder, following certain tips can help in providing a much needed peaceful and a healthy sleep.

The simple habits of improving one’s daytime habits and creating a better sleep environment can help in laying the foundation for a good sleep. Setting up a proper schedule and a routine helps in disciplining one’s body which in turn ensures that one sleeps at one’s expected time. It has been found that regular exercises during the day help in tiring a person thereby providing a relaxing and a peaceful sleep during night time. Regular exercises do not imply going for hard-core physical activities. Instead, it means indulging in keeping oneself active and preferably going in for walks in the evening which along with aiding in the overall health of a person, help in setting up of a proper sleeping schedule of a person. Moreover, one should avoid afternoon naps as they generally interrupt in providing a person with night’s sleep.

To get a better sleep at night, one should minimize and even stop the intake of alcohol and caffeine as they hamper the sleep quality and health of a person. Women can face disturbed sleeps due to a deficiency of iron in their body. Such women should increase their iron intake through diet or through health supplements. Moreover, the best way of ensuring a proper and a peaceful sleep is by creating a better sleep environment for oneself. This involves having a comfortable bed with proper mattresses and pillows so as to avoid back related problems. In addition, one should ensure that one’s room is well ventilated with minimum noise and disturbance during night time. It is always better to keep your room dark during night as it would tell your body clock to sleep on time. Following some basic tips, one can ensure a good night’s sleep for oneself which would play an important part in keeping one’s body and mind in a healthy condition.
